Synopsis "Genetic Engineering"

Genetic engineering is one of the most transformative scientific advancements of the modern era. Over the past few decades, remarkable progress in molecular biology and biotechnology has enabled scientists to understand, manipulate, and redesign genetic material with extraordinary precision. These developments have revolutionized many fields including medicine, agriculture, industry, and environmental science. The ability to modify DNA has opened new possibilities for treating genetic diseases, improving crop productivity, producing pharmaceuticals, and exploring fundamental biological processes.
This book, "Genetic Engineering", has been written to provide a clear, comprehensive, and accessible understanding of the principles, techniques, and applications of genetic engineering. It is designed primarily for undergraduate and postgraduate students of life sciences, biotechnology, microbiology, and related disciplines. At the same time, the book may also serve as a useful reference for researchers, teachers, and anyone interested in understanding how modern biotechnology works.
The chapters of this book are organized in a logical sequence, beginning with the basic concepts of molecular biology and genetics. Early chapters introduce the structure and function of DNA, gene expression, and the molecular tools used in genetic manipulation. These fundamental topics form the foundation necessary to understand advanced techniques used in genetic engineering.
Subsequent chapters explore essential laboratory methods such as recombinant DNA technology, cloning vectors, polymerase chain reaction (PCR), gel electrophoresis, and DNA sequencing. These techniques are the backbone of modern biotechnology and are widely used in research laboratories across the world. By presenting these methods in a clear and structured way, the book aims to help students understand not only the theoretical principles but also their practical applications.
Later sections of the book discuss the applications of genetic engineering in microorganisms, plants, and animals. The development of genetically modified organisms (GMOs), production of recombinant proteins, vaccine development, and gene therapy are described in detail. These applications demonstrate how genetic engineering has contributed significantly to healthcare, agriculture, and industrial biotechnology.
The book also addresses the ethical, legal, and social aspects associated with genetic engineering. As powerful technologies such as genome editing continue to advance, society must carefully consider issues related to biosafety, bioethics, and responsible use of biotechnology. Understanding these aspects is essential for developing a balanced perspective on the benefits and potential risks of genetic manipulation.
Special attention has been given to presenting scientific concepts in simple language while maintaining academic accuracy. Technical terms are explained clearly, and a comprehensive glossary has been included to help readers understand important terminology. References and further readings are also provided to encourage deeper exploration of the subject.
The field of genetic engineering continues to evolve rapidly with new discoveries and innovative technologies emerging every year. Techniques such as advanced genome editing, synthetic biology, and systems biology are expanding the possibilities of biological research and biotechnology. It is hoped that this book will serve as a useful guide for students and researchers seeking to understand these developments and their impact on science and society.
Finally, the author hopes that this book will inspire curiosity and interest in the fascinating world of genetics and biotechnology.
